The differences between assistant professors of environmental science and assistant professors of education can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, an assistant professor of environmental science has an average salary of $77,896, which is higher than the $60,188 average annual salary of an assistant professor of education.
The top three skills for an assistant professor of environmental science include environmental science, course materials and environmental studies. The most important skills for an assistant professor of education are educational leadership, teacher education, and K-12.
